Although he had a standout collegiate career at Georgetown, Allen Iverson still had a lot to prove after being the shortest player ever to be drafted first overall. That was 1996. In his rookie season, Iverson broke records by scoring at least 40 points in five straight games and was eventually named Rookie of the Year. In just his third season, he helped the Sixers reach the playoffs as he led the league with an average of 26.8 points per game. Twenty years after he was drafted by the 76ers, he was elected to the Basketball Hall of Fame in a class that included Shaquille O'Neal and Yao Ming.
